Founded in 1999, Reef Runner Sailing School is an American Sailing certified and accredited school based in Friendship, Maine, a beautiful working waterfront town in the heart of Midcoast Maine. Whether this is your first time on a sailboat or you’re ready to earn your bareboat certification, we offer a complete pathway from beginner to advanced sailor.

Our courses follow the proven American Sailing curriculum, ranging from ASA 101 Basic Keelboat all the way through ASA 106 Advanced Coastal Cruising, with catamaran endorsements and specialty courses also available. We offer both standalone classes and popular multi-day combo packages, including our 7-day live-aboard Basic & Bareboat Combo — one of the most immersive ways to earn three ASA certifications in a single week. All ASA certifications earned here are recognized globally by bareboat charter companies worldwide.

One thing that sets Reef Runner Sailing apart is our commitment to small class sizes. We typically limit classes to just 2–4 students, which means you’ll spend significantly more time at the helm than you would in a larger school setting. You learn by doing, not by watching.

Our primary teaching boat, Atlas, is a Pearson 31-2, a fully equipped monohull sailboat. S/V Atlas is forgiving for beginners yet responsive enough to develop real skills.

Our lead instructor and owner, Captain Jeremy, has been recognized as an ASA Outstanding Instructor of the Year four consecutive years. He brings patience, deep expertise, and a genuine passion for teaching that keeps students coming back.

Sailing in Midcoast Maine means real conditions — tidal currents, open coastal waters, and stunning scenery. It’s the perfect classroom.
